Transaction 420e3a9ff178f507a473d19729950bbbf4dfe033339e7618b59aeef15147ffe2

6 Input
2 Outputs
  • 420e3a9ff178f507a473d19729950bbbf4dfe033339e7618b59aeef15147ffe2:0
  • value  903427
    address  15MC515jnTQzZrXJ9aCSWdEzNLLGYMjaTR
  • 420e3a9ff178f507a473d19729950bbbf4dfe033339e7618b59aeef15147ffe2:1
  • value  314370306
    address  1NDyJtNTjmwk5xPNhjgAMu4HDHigtobu1s